Vegfest Scotland will be taking place on 5th and 6th December in Hall 3 of the SECC in Glasgow and will be showcasing a number of local ethical companies such as Vegan 'Sheese' producers Bute Island Foods, Glasgow-based wholesalers GreenCity Wholefoods and vegan restaurant Mono Cafe Bar.

vegfest scotland vegan glasgow secc

As well as a hall full of stalls with information, Vegfest Scotland has space for 14 caterers bringing home a wide range of global vegan cuisines, as well as a series of cookery demos and living raw food demos showing you how to get the best out of plant-based ingredients in your everyday dishes.

Saturday sees a Health Summit with dieticians, healthcare professionals and health researchers. Confirmed speakers include nutritionists Gareth Zeal, Sandra Hood and Yvonne Bishop-Weston, health counsellors Bill Tara and Marlene Watson-Tara and dietitian Matt Ruscigno.

vegfest scotland vegan glasgow seccThere will also be music, comedy and fun!

Tickets are priced at £5 for one day and £8 for the whole weekend - these go on sale from September at the show website www.vegfestscotland.com You can also buy tickets on the gate at £8 for adults / £4 for concessions (subject to availability). Kids under 16 get free entry.
